#696a23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#696a23 is composed of 41.2% red, 41.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#696a23 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2d446 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#696a23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#696a23 has RGB values of R:105, G:106,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6908451.

Shades and Tints of #696a23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#696a23
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494944 is the less saturated color, while #898b02 is the most saturated one.
